While Lenox itself may not have a residential rehab facility, nearby cities in Iowa offer various levels of care. You can explore outpatient programs that allow you to receive therapy and support while living at home. These often include individual counseling, group sessions, and educational workshops. For more intensive support, inpatient or residential facilities provide a structured environment away from daily triggers. These programs are designed to help you build a solid foundation for sobriety through medical supervision, detox services if needed, and comprehensive therapeutic approaches. When contacting a rehab center, don't hesitate to ask questions. Inquire about their treatment philosophies, the credentials of their staff, and whether they accept your insurance. Many facilities offer personalized plans that address co-occurring issues like anxiety or depression, which are common alongside addiction. It's also helpful to ask about aftercare planning, as ongoing support is crucial for long-term recovery. Support doesn't end when formal treatment does; local resources like support groups in Creston or Corning can provide continued community.
